Beginning fall 2009, Mennonite College of Nursing will be increasing student enrollment for the traditional Prelicensure B.S.N. sequence by adding a second point of entry into the sequence. The admission cycle will remain the same, but accepted students will be offered either fall or spring entry points into the program. The college will balance these entry points in order to increase the total number of accepted students each academic year while managing available resources and maintaining program quality.
Applications for the Traditional Prelicensure B.S.N. sequence may be submitted by all current Illinois State students who were not accepted into the freshman Early Admission Sequence AND all students not currently attending Illinois State University within one year of anticipated nursing admission (i.e. if a student plans on starting the nursing sequence in fall of 2009/spring 2010, s/he may fill out an application between 9/1/08 – 1/15/09.) Students will be informed of their admission status between 2/15/09 – 3/15/09.
